I used topspin against my opponent, suddenly my opponent block my topspin use his bat like a 'cobra'.. I called it 'cobra' stroke. I dont know what the official name of that stroke.. and also the return ball is more powerful. im stuck at counter it.. help me..


Alois Rosario
Member Badge Alois Rosario Answered 15 years ago

Hi,

Sounds like this opponent has a good counter attack.  Think about moving the ball around to different positions to stop this stroke.  See where he likes it from and then change the direction of your attack.  Sometimes this will make a big difference.
